Description | Phosphoglycolic acid, also known as phosphoglycolate or glycolate-2-p, belongs to the class of organic compounds known as monoalkyl phosphates. These are organic compounds containing a phosphate group that is linked to exactly one alkyl chain. Phosphoglycolic acid is a moderately acidic compound (based on its pKa). Phosphoglycolic acid exists in all living species, ranging from bacteria to humans. |
